Professional Pet Photography is Different
Professional Pet Photography Includes:
- Controlled lighting for fur texture, eye clarity, and color accuracy
- Experience working with animals of all temperaments and ages
- Intentional posing that respects anatomy and behavior
- Image finishing designed for print longevity, not just screens
- Artwork planning — wall displays, albums, and heirloom prints

Our Approach to Pet Photography in Idaho
Calm. Patient. Structured.
We photograph pets the way professionals photograph people — with preparation, adaptability, and respect.
Our process includes:
- Pre-session consultation (temperament, energy level, goals)
- Studio or outdoor session planning
- Safety-first handling and pacing
- Breaks as needed — never rushed
- Professional retouching that preserves realism
- Guided artwork selection after the session
This approach allows us to photograph:
- Puppies and senior pets
- High-energy breeds
- Anxious or reactive animals
- Multiple pets together
- Pets with their owners (optional)

Pet Photography FAQs
How long does a professional pet photography session take?
Most professional pet photography sessions last between 45 and 90 minutes, depending on the pet’s temperament, energy level, comfort level, and whether multiple pets are involved. We do not rush animals. The goal is to create calm, expressive portraits that feel natural and polished.
Can you photograph anxious or reactive pets?
Yes. Professional pet photography sessions are paced around the animal. Experience, patience, and adaptability allow for successful sessions even with anxious, shy, energetic, or reactive pets. We work carefully, avoid forcing poses, and create space for your pet to settle into the session.
Do you photograph pets with their owners?
Yes. Many clients choose to include themselves in pet portraits to capture the bond between owner and companion. These portraits can be especially meaningful for families who want emotional artwork that celebrates the relationship they share with their pet.
Is pet photography done in a studio or outdoors?
Pet photography sessions can be done in-studio or outdoors. The environment is selected based on the pet’s personality, comfort, safety, and the desired final artwork. Some pets do best in a controlled studio setting, while others are more relaxed outdoors.
Do you offer finished artwork or only digital files?
Professional pet photography sessions are designed around finished artwork such as framed wall portraits, fine art prints, albums, and heirloom displays. Digital images may be available depending on the collection, but the primary goal is to create lasting artwork worthy of display.
